Novices Guide to Metal Polishing - Generally, metal finishing is needed for an attractive appearance as well as clean-room usages. It really is among the most widely used treatments simply because of its utility in intensifying the natural beauty of the items, such as, automobile parts, kitchenware or motor bike parts. Besides that, a good number of clean-rooms will want a shiny finish to lower the perviousness of the material which will cause dust to build up and contaminate. A great demonstration of this practice would be in a vacuum chamber.

There are actually a great many means to polish metals, and let us take a look at several of the steps required. Various metals can be polished by hand, with purpose built buffing machines, electromechanically or chemically. A polishing paste or compound may be employed, which may incorporate limestone, aluminum oxide, dolomite, chalk, chromium oxide, tripoli, or iron oxide.

Buffing stainless steel, due to its low th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its relatively high viscidity is just about the time-consuming. However, things made out of non-ferrous metals tend to be receptive to polishing, since these demand the minimum number of operations.

Finishing buffs smeared in paste will be somewhat affected by the force on the pad. The level of the surface pressure may be amplified to a chosen range, however further overreaching the ideal level of load not just cuts down on the quality of treatment, but in addition reduces the level of efficiency, can lead to wear on the product, and there is also an obvious heating up of the work-pieces, resulting from friction. When you are working on thinner metal, it's greater temperature (and a relating bendability of the metal) that cause elements to distort, warp or buckle. Generally, it will take a skilled polisher to think about each one of these points to both not cause damage to the piece and to operate efficiently. To help you substantially boost the quality of the resulting finish, the buffing procedure must be implemented with less power and not as much force so that you may consequently produce a surface that doesn't have any scratches or marks left behind by the polishing procedure, subsequently arriving at a lovely mirror finish.
